Metal roof installation services involve the process of fitting durable metal roofing materials onto residential, commercial, or industrial properties. Skilled contractors assess the structure, prepare the existing roof if necessary, and securely install panels made from materials such as steel, aluminum, copper, or zinc. The installation process often includes ensuring proper sealing, fastening, and alignment to provide a weather-tight barrier that can withstand various environmental conditions. Properly installed metal roofs are designed to offer long-lasting performance and can be customized to match the aesthetic preferences of property owners.
This service addresses several common roofing concerns, including issues related to leaks, roof deterioration, and the need for increased durability. Metal roofing is resistant to issues like rot, mold, and insect damage, which can affect traditional asphalt or wood shingles. Additionally, metal roofs are capable of withstanding high winds, heavy snow, and hail, reducing the risk of damage during severe weather events. Proper installation can also improve energy efficiency by reflecting sunlight and reducing cooling costs, making it a practical choice for those seeking to enhance the resilience and efficiency of their properties.

Material Costs - The cost of materials for metal roof installation typically ranges from $3 to $10 per square foot, depending on the type of metal chosen, such as steel or aluminum. For a standard 2,000-square-foot roof, material expenses can vary from $6,000 to $20,000.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ific material preferences.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for installing a metal roof generally fall between $4,000 and $12,000 for an average-sized home. These costs depend on the complexity of the roof design and local labor rates. It is advisable to get quotes from multiple service providers for accurate pricing.
Additional Fees - Extra charges may include removal of existing roofing, which can add $1,000 to $3,000, and permits or inspections that might cost around $100 to $500. These fees vary based on local regulations and the scope of the project.
Overall Cost Range - The total cost for metal roof installation typically ranges from $10,000 to $30,000, depending on factors like roof size, material choice, and additional services. Contact local contractors for personalized estimates tailored to specific project need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
